"Country Music" delves into the rich history of America's beloved genre, tracing its roots from the rural South to its national prominence, fueled by the rise of radio in the 1920s. This engaging narrative highlights the lives and journeys of iconic musicians like Hank Williams, Dolly Parton, and Loretta Lynn, along with insights from contemporary stars such as Merle Haggard and Garth Brooks. With captivating anecdotes and a sweeping overview, it invites both devoted fans and newcomers to explore the profound impact of country music on the American cultural landscape.
